Favourite Destination for experience:

Mauritius Tea plantations, waterfalls, beautiful white sand beaches fringed with turquoise seas, Visit the rum factory and discover rum made in every flavour possible. For a tiny island Mauritius has incredibly rich and diverse food culture, infused with Creole, French, Chinese and Indian influences.


Street food is fantastic in Mauritius – you can get everything from fresh coconut water, chopped fruit covered in chilli and sugar, hot curries topped with chilli and pickles wrapped in buttery breads, Chinese fried noodles that are cooked in front of you. However if you love gourmet food then the choice is unbelievable amazing restaurants to choose from.
